Spirituality can be very philosophical, motivational and not always practical. But spirituality was meant to change the world. Jesus used it to transform the world around him, until the Romans got their hands on it and we became lazy with our eschatology (topic for another day). Jesus coming through the clouds would be great, but what would be more practical is to see the love of Jesus. Wouldn't that be crazy, for the love of Jesus to be evident in the characters of the believers, and for Spirituality to change everything.
What if we could create an activity that would enhance our spirituality, financial freedom, and improve our community? Imagine with me for a moment...
